Transaction 31c434d86d2235c9c5ce14e21c39fb8e3ca99266683d87f1ef4e51a5dbc3ea0c
1 Input
1 Output
-
31c434d86d2235c9c5ce14e21c39fb8e3ca99266683d87f1ef4e51a5dbc3ea0c:0
- value
- 2986644
- script pubkey
- OP_0 OP_PUSHBYTES_20 81f2aa945394c61440e700d78461b90eec84ea89
- address
- bc1qs8e249znjnrpgs88qrtcgcdepmkgf65fdqcmr3